[PATCH V2] powerpc/powernv: Remove support for p5ioc2

Russell Currey ruscur at russell.cc
Wed Jan 13 18:04:41 AEDT 2016


"p5ioc2 is used by approximately 2 machines in the world, and has never
ever been a supported configuration."

The code for p5ioc2 is essentially unused and complicates what is already
a very complicated codebase.  Its removal is essentially a "free win" in
the effort to simplify the powernv PCI code.

In addition, support for p5ioc2 has been dropped from skiboot.  There's no
reason to keep it around in the kernel.
